How VIP Tiers Work
Tier structures vary from casino to casino, but they usually follow a familiar pattern: you earn points, points convert to tiers, tiers unlock benefits. Simple, though the details are where casinos differentiate themselves.
- Earn loyalty points through real-money play and promotions.
- Accumulate points to reach higher tiers within a set time frame.
- Redeem points for cashback, bonus credit, or prizes.

Payments & Redemption
One of the most immediate benefits of VIP status is improved payment handling. Faster withdrawal windows, higher limits and, sometimes, waived fees — these matter more than they might sound. Managing cash flow is a real thing for players who take gambling seriously.
- Priority processing cuts waiting time from days to hours.
- Higher withdrawal caps give flexibility for larger wins.
- Exclusive payout methods occasionally offered to VIPs.
There is also a psychological layer: when withdrawals are smooth, players feel less friction and can enjoy the entertainment without the nagging worry about cashing out.
